Sean Caton Memorial Foundation

The sean caton memorial foundation was started to honor the memory of christopher sean caton who was killed during the september 11, 2001 terrorist attacks on the world trade center in new york city. the foundation has made monetary contributions to glen rock high school, glen rock, new jersey to create the september 11th scholorship fund in memory or sean caton, class of 1985. the money is used for a collegiate scholorship to a graduate or glen rock high school. the foundation has made additional contributions to other irc section 501(c)(3) organizations as well. the foundation raises it funds from contributions from the general public. in addition, an annual fund raising dinner is held. all proceeds are used to further the goals of the foundation.
